Koko (1940) requires more than one listening. The bass is playd by the legendary Jimmie Blanton, the baritone sax by Harry Carney, the greatest bari player, the trombone solo by Tricky Sam Nanton, the man who could 'speak' through his 'bone, the piano by Duke, who laid down a solo - nearly 70 years ago - that was completely unheard of in 1940. But the most intriguing and exciting is the magical 'together' way the band plays the fantastic arrangement, which may have been intended as dance music.
